A joint research team in the College of Pharmacy, University of Al-Mustansiriyah conducted an online joint study on manufacturing a series of new anti-bacterial 4-thiazolidinone-pharmacur 5 (a-d)). The joint study reviewed diagnosing the chemical composition of medium and final compounds via using spectroscopy (FT-IR) and (1 H-NMR) and testing them against several types of bacteria by technical good spread as anti-microbial agents. The joint study aimed at stimulating of molecular anchoring via Eldoquin programs for the most active compounds in the area of the active protein of bacteria. The joint study concluded that the compounds of 5b and 5c possess a clear inhibition activity and against different types of negative and G-positive bacteria if compared to the standard drug known as trimethoprim.
